Responsibilities and Skills:
Partner with the various lines of business to develop and enhance Capital Markets modeling and analytical framework, such as deposit predictions, derivatives models and fixed income models.
Work across Capital One entities to create novel analytical solutions to challenging business problems.
Identify opportunities to apply quantitative methods and automation solutions to improve business performance and process efficiencies.
Collaborate in a cross-disciplinary team to build cloud-based solutions grounded in data.
Identify opportunities to apply quantitative methods or machine learning to improve business performance.
Apply deep expertise in mathematics, statistical and machine learning methods to generate critical insights and decision frameworks for our business and customers.
Providing technical guidance to business leadership.
Communicate technical subject matter clearly and concisely to individuals from various backgrounds.
Understand and navigate Risk Management Software to enable business analysis.
Successful candidates would possess:
Deep understanding of quantitative modeling in relation to finance, deposit behaviors, capital markets and investment portfolio modeling principles.
Extensive experience in Python or other object-oriented language.
Ability to clearly communicate modeling results to a wide range of audiences.
Drive to develop and maintain high quality and transparent model documentation.
Strong written and verbal communication skills.
Strong presentation skills.
Ability to fully own the model development process: from conceptualization through data exploration, model selection, validation, deployment, business user training, and monitoring.
Basic Qualifications:
Currently has, or is in the process of obtaining a Bachelor’s Degree plus at least 6 years of experience in data analytics, or currently has, or is in the process of obtaining a Master’s Degree plus at least 4 years of experience in data analytics, or currently has, or is in the process of obtaining PhD plus at least 1 year of experience in data analytics, financial modeling or econometric modeling (can include Graduate School Research work) with an expectation that required degree will be obtained on or before the scheduled start date.
Preferred Qualifications:
PhD in Statistics, Economics, Mathematics, Financial Engineering, Operations Research, Engineering, Finance, Physics or related disciplines.
5+ years of experience in statistical modeling, regression analytics or machine learning.
4+ years of credit risk modeling experience for commercial banks (default probability, loss given default, or exposure at default.)
2+ years of experience managing a team of analysts.
